93 940 Brake ??'s 900

I need to start thinking about replacing the brakes on my 93 940 Wagon.
I may need new rotors in the rear for sure, I had it to the dealer to check out a rattle in the rear(fodder for another post!)and was advised that the rear rotors were warped. Although I do feel it all when braking or driving. The fronts were replaced at about 45K. It now has 66K on it. I don't need any high performance equipment, just standard fare.
Questions:

1. Are aftermarket rotors available and are they less expensive then the Volvo parts? How much should I expect to pay? Are they readily available or should I order in advance?

2. Do the front rotors need to be resurfaced each time pads are installed and is it difficult to DIY the new pads? Is the DIY process posted anywhere? Don't know if I saw it in the 700/900 FAQ.

3. What other acceptable pads besides the Volvo replacements do you gents suggest? Approximate cost?


Thanks! John
